Solar Energy Analysis for White Hall, AR

Solar Radiation Data in White Hall

Based on historical White Hall, AR data, solar panels that are tilted towards the equator at an angle equal to the latitude will produce the maximum solar energy output in White Hall. [1]

White Hall has an average monthly Global Horizontal Irradiance (GHI) of 4.5 kilowatt hours per square meter per day (kWh/m2/day), which is approximately equal to the average monthly Direct Normal Irradiance (DNI) of 4.5 kWh/m2/day. [1]

Solar installations in White Hall that are always titled at the latitude of White Hall (Average Tilt at Latitude or ATaL) average 5.06 kWh/m2/day, or about 12% greater than the average monthly GHI of 4.5 kWh/m2/day and approximately 12% greater than the average monthly DNI of 4.5 kWh/m2/day. [1]

Solar Energy Glossary

Global Horizontal Irradiance (GHI)

Global Horizontal Irradiance: The total amount of solar radiation that is received per unit area by a surface that is always positioned in a horizontal manner.

Direct Normal Irradiance (DNI)

Direct Normal Irradiance: The total amount of solar radiation received per unit area by a surface that is always perpendicular to the sun rays that come in a straight line from the direction of the sun at its current position in the sky.

Average Tilt at Latitude (ATaL)

Average Tilt at Latitude: The total amount of solar radiation received per unit area by a surface that is tilted toward the equator at an angle equal to the current latitude. ATaL will often produce the optimum energy output.

Solar Radiation Analysis for White Hall, AR

Solar Radiation Data in White Hall

White Hall, AR has a average annual solar radiation value of 5.26 kilowatt hours per square meter per day (kWh/m2/day). [1]

The month with the highest historical solar radition values in White Hall is September with an average of 6.09 kWh/m2/day, followed by June at 5.9 kWh/m2/day and August at 5.83 kWh/m2/day. [1]

The three months that historically average the lowest average solar radiation levels in White Hall (Arkansas) are December with an average of 4.03 kWh/m2/day, followed by January with an average of 4.19 kWh/m2/day and February at 4.52 kWh/m2/day. [1]

Solar Output Analysis for White Hall, AR

Solar Radiation Data in White Hall

White Hall (AR) has a average annual solar AC output value of 5825.56 kilowatt hours (AC). [2]

The month with the highest historical solar power output in White Hall is September with an average of 543.76 kWhac, followed by October at 524.85 kWhac and July at 522.94 kWhac. [2]

The three months that historically average the lowest average solar output levels in White Hall (Arkansas) are December with an average of 398.67 kWhac, followed by February with an average of 400.06 kWhac and January at 417.22 kWhac. [2]
